correo electrónico: hmail solución

16
UF3 ASIX 2M Alumno: Francesc de Miguel Casals Profesor: Francesc Pérez Fernández

Upload: francesc-perez

Post on 02-Jun-2015

550 views

Category:

Education


0 download

TRANSCRIPT

Page 1: Correo electrónico: HMAIL Solución

UF3

ASIX 2M

Alumno: Francesc de Miguel Casals

Profesor: Francesc Pérez Fernández

Page 2: Correo electrónico: HMAIL Solución

SERXAR--SMTP

Índice

_____________________________________________________________________________

1. Instalación y configuración del servidor HMailServer

1.1 Añadir dominio1.2 Configurar los límites de memoria1.3 Creación de los usuarios del dominio1.4 Habilitar los protocolos y el registro para las actividades SMTP, POP3 y TCP/IP.

2. Instalación y configuración del cliente gráfico

2.1 Archivo hosts2.2 Configurar las cuentas de los cliente para el envío y recepción de correo SMTP e

IMAP.2.3 Realizar pruebas de envío y recepción de correos entre cuentas del dominio

local.

3. Configuración del cliente sin entorno gráfico

3.1 Conexión con el servidor SMTP para el envío de correo3.2 Conexión con el servidor POP3 para la recepción de correo

4. Configuración de ClamWin como antivirus para el servicio de correo

2 |

Page 3: Correo electrónico: HMAIL Solución

SERXAR--SMTP

Introducción

En esta práctica administraremos un dominio de correo electrónico con el servidor hMailServer . Es una aplicación que implementa los protocolos de servidor SMTP, POP3 e IMAP.

ESQUEMA

3 |

Page 4: Correo electrónico: HMAIL Solución

SERXAR--SMTP

1. Instalación y configuración del servidor HMailServer

1.1 Añadir dominio

Antes de añadir el dominio debemos instalar HMailServer con las opciones por defecto y el usuario administrador con contraseña “12345”

1.2 Configurar los límites de memoria

4 |

Para crear el dominio hacemos clic en Add domain, y configuramos los parámetros del dominio de correo electrónico.

En esta pestaña configuraremos la capacidad máxima de memoria de disco duro que ocupará el dominio.

Se ha de destacar que la más importante es Max size of accounts, la cual es el total máximo de memoria para todas las cuentas existentes en el dominio

Y también vemos que la opción número máximo de cuentas está habilitada y establecida en 50.

Page 5: Correo electrónico: HMAIL Solución

SERXAR--SMTP

1.3 Creación de los usuarios y cuentas del dominio

1.4 Habilitar los protocolos y el registro para las actividades SMTP, POP3 y TCP/IP.

5 |

Aquí es donde se generan las cuentas de correo directamente en el servidor.

En las imágenes podemos ver la creación de las cuentas de Franperezcrack y lopez.

En esta imagen se ven los resultados finales de creación de las cuentas mencionadas arriba.

Estas imágenes son correspondientes a la habilitación de los protocolos SMTP, POP3 e IMAP.

Y también correspondientes al registro de actividades de dichos protocolos.

Para visualizar dichos resultados debemos ir a Status Logging en el servidor.

Page 6: Correo electrónico: HMAIL Solución

SERXAR--SMTP

2. Instalación y configuración del cliente gráfico

2.1 Archivo hosts

6 |

En la imagen SMTP requiere autenticación de usuario para el envío de correo, pero en la práctica se ha realizado sin dicha autentificación.

Deshabilitarlo supone un problema de seguridad ya que no forzamos a que el usuario se identifique con lo que hay riesgo de suplantación de identidad.

A “grosso” modo hay dos maneras de re direccionar todas las peticiones de correo del cliente hacia el servidor.

Una sería generar la topología con un servidor DNS implementado en ella.

La otra es gestionar el archivo hosts.txt del cliente. Simplemente hemos de añadir la IP y el nombre del servidor de correo:

Ip mail.nombreservidor.net (por ejemplo).

Page 7: Correo electrónico: HMAIL Solución

SERXAR--SMTP

2.2 Configurar las cuentas de los cliente para el envío y recepción de correo SMTP e IMAP.

7 |

Configuramos en el cliente de correo los servidores SMTP y POP3. Observe que el envío SMTP no requiere autenticación por parte del usuario, la contraseña se utiliza para la recepción de correo con POP3.

Page 8: Correo electrónico: HMAIL Solución

SERXAR--SMTP

2.3 Realizar pruebas de envío y recepción de correos entre cuentas del dominio.

4.14.2

8 |

El usuario lopez a diferencia de franperezcrack gestionará su mailbox con el protocolo IMAP. POP3 e IMAP poseen diferencias notables, como por ejemplo la habilidad de trabajar offline. Ambos usuarios envían correo utilizando SMTP

En este paso simplemente verificamos que se puedan recibir y enviar correos electrónicos entre los usuarios del dominio local que hemos generado.

Page 9: Correo electrónico: HMAIL Solución

SERXAR--SMTP

3. Configuración del cliente sin entorno gráfico

3.1 Conexión con el servidor SMTP para el envío de correo

3.2 Conexión con el servidor POP3 para la recepción de correo

En esta segunda imagen nos conectamos por telnet al mailbox del usuario franperezcrack con POP3

Vemos como se abre la sesión, introduciendo user y el nombre de la cuenta y a continuación la contraseña de la cuenta. Una vez dentro para visualizar los mensajes del buzón de entrada, debemos poner el comando list y top.

OTROS COMANDOS SMTP

9 |

En este paso se puede ver como realizamos el envío del correo a través de un telnet.

Para ello usaremos una serie de comandos para conectarnos al dominio, y enviar un correo de lopez a Franperezcrack.

Un poco más abajo podremos ver un listado de los comandos más comunes de cada protocolo.

Page 10: Correo electrónico: HMAIL Solución

SERXAR--SMTP

AUTH [Método], DATA, EHLO [servidor], EXPN [lista de correo], HELO [servidor], HELP [comandos], MAIL FROM [mail], NOOP, QUIT, RCPT TO, RSET, TURN, VRFY [nombre].

AUTH: Sirve para autentificarse ante el servidor, empleando el método indicado, para cifrar el usuario y la contraseña.

DATA: Especifica al servidor SMTP que a partir de la siguiente línea se empezará a escribir el mensaje (cabecera y contenido). Para indicar que el mensaje se ha completado, se escribirá una línea con solamente un punto (.). A partir de ahí, el servidor enviará el mensaje.

EHLO: Permite que el servidor nos envíe una lista de las extensiones «modernas» del protocolo

SMTP que soporta. De esta manera, se comprueba la compatibilidad con los comandos del protocolo simple de transferencia de correo extendido (ESMTP).

EXPN: Este comando sirve para pedir listas de correo del servidor.

HELO: Comando para abrir el dialogo SMTP. Lo envía un cliente para identificarse a sí mismo.

HELP: Devuelve una lista de los comandos compatibles con el servicio SMTP. Si se especifica un parámetro, el servidor nos enviará información referente al comando escrito.

MAIL _FROM_ Identifica al remitente del mensaje.

NOOP: Sirve para comprobar que la conexión con el servidor sigue activa o que el servicio que ofrece sigue disponible. El servidor debe responder con un OK.

QUIT: Cierra la conexión con el servidor.

RCPT__TO: Especifica los destinatarios del mensaje.

RSET: Aborta el envío actual y reinicia la comunicación desde el momento en que se creó la conexión.

TURN: El emisor cede el turno al receptor para que actúe como emisor sin tener que establecer una conexión nueva.

VRFY: Comprueba que un buzón está disponible para la entrega de mensajes.

OTROS COMANDOS POP3

10 |

Page 11: Correo electrónico: HMAIL Solución

SERXAR--SMTP

USER [nombre_usuario], PASS [contraseña], STAT, NOOP, LIST [mensaje], RETR [mensaje], DELE [mensaje], RSET, QUIT

USER: Sirve para autentificarse ante el servidor. Indica el nombre del usuario al que pertenece el buzón de correo existente.

PASS: Sirve para autentificarse ante el servidor, indicando la contraseña del usuario

STAT: Sirve para obtener un resumen de la información correspondiente al buzón.

NOOP: Sirve para comprobar que la conexión con el servidor sigue activa o que el servicio que ofrece sigue disponible. Al ejecutar este comando el servidor debe responder con un OK.

LIST: Sirve para listar un mensaje. Si en el éste no puede referirse a ninguno que se haya marcado como borrado.

RETR: Sirve para recuperar la información completa de un determinado mensaje.

DELE: Sirve para marcar como borrado un determinado mensaje. Estos mensajes permanecerán en la cuenta hasta que el servidor pase a la fase de actualización. Después, desaparecerán definitivamente.

RSET: Sirve para anular la marca de borrado que tengan activa los mensajes existentes en el buzón.

QUIT: Cierra la conexión con el servidor.

3.3 Configuración de ClamWin como antivirus para el servicio de correo

11 |

Page 12: Correo electrónico: HMAIL Solución

SERXAR--SMTP

Utilice ClamWin como antivirus para el servicio de correo.

Cuando el servidor detecte un virus debe eliminar el correo y notificar el evento al remitente.

Bloquee sólo aquellos correos que contengan un archivo.bat

12 |

Page 13: Correo electrónico: HMAIL Solución

SERXAR--SMTP

Como administrador de correo del dominio envíe un mensaje a todos los usuarios del dominio informando acerca de una parada técnica del servicio por tareas de mantenimiento.

Para realizar dicha tarea debemos dirigirnos al apartado Utilities donde encontraremos Server sendout.

Una vez allí vemos dos apartados:

- Send to: Hay tres opciones.

All accounts: Esta opción habilita el envío de los correos sendout a todas las cuentas de todos los dominios.Specific domain: Esta opción es algo más rectrictiva. Se refiere a todas las cuentas de un solo dominio. (El que elijamos)

Accounts matching wildcard: Esta es aún más restrictiva ya que se refiere a una cuenta en concreto. La podemos seleccionar mediante la wildcard (¿tarjeta salvaje?).

- Email: Simplemente hemos de introducir:

From (Name): Nombre de quien envía el mensaje.From (Address): Dirección de correo electrónico de quien la envía.Subject: El título del mensaje del sendout.

13 |

Page 14: Correo electrónico: HMAIL Solución

SERXAR--SMTP

Una vez enviado el correo sendout podemos ver en la bandeja de entrada de todas la cuentas, como se ha recibido el correo.

14 |